Understanding the Importance of CEUs

Continuing Education Units (CEUs) are essential for nurses to maintain their licenses, advance their knowledge, and stay updated with the latest healthcare practices. However, the process of completing these units can be stressful if not managed properly. This guide aims to provide strategies for achieving stress-free CEU completion.

CEUs are not just a requirement; they are an opportunity for professional growth. Embracing this mindset can transform how you approach your learning journey. By viewing CEUs as a chance to enhance your skills and contribute to better patient care, you can reduce the pressure and enjoy the process.

Effective Time Management

One of the biggest challenges nurses face is managing time effectively to complete their CEUs. Balancing work, personal life, and continuing education requires careful planning. Here are some tips to help you manage your schedule:

  • Set realistic goals: Break down your CEU requirements into manageable chunks and set achievable deadlines.
  • Create a study schedule: Allocate specific times each week dedicated to studying and stick to this routine.
  • Utilize downtime: Use breaks at work or during commutes to review materials or listen to educational podcasts.

Leveraging Online Resources

The digital age has brought a plethora of online resources that make completing CEUs more convenient than ever. Online courses offer flexibility and are often self-paced, allowing you to learn at your own speed. When searching for courses, ensure they are accredited and accepted by your licensing board.

Additionally, many platforms offer free or discounted courses for healthcare professionals. Take advantage of these opportunities to expand your knowledge without breaking the bank. Engaging in forums and online study groups can also provide support and motivation.

Staying Motivated and Avoiding Burnout

Maintaining motivation throughout the CEU process is crucial. Setting short-term goals and rewarding yourself upon completion can help keep you motivated. Remember that taking breaks is essential to avoid burnout; consider using techniques like the Pomodoro Technique to maintain focus while ensuring regular rest periods.

Finding a study buddy or joining a study group can also add a social element to your learning, making it more enjoyable. Sharing insights and discussing topics with peers can enhance understanding and retention of information.

Utilizing Employer Resources

Many healthcare organizations offer resources and support for nurses pursuing CEUs. Check if your employer provides access to workshops, seminars, or funding for courses. Engaging with these resources can significantly ease the financial and logistical burdens of continuing education.
